PREMIER LEAGUE TITLE IS THE WORTH OF LEICESTER CITY FANTASTIC SEASON SAYS ALBRIGHTON
Leicester City midfielder Marc Albrighton says the Foxes' "massive transformation" will mean nothing if they don't with the Premier League this season.
With a seven point advantage over closest challengers Tottenham, the Foxes are the bookmakers' favourite to lift the trophy. And the 26-year-old says anything less than a Prem crown won't do.
"It has been going on so long that we keep saying a year ago today," Albrighton told the Mirror.
"Where we were to this, it is a massive transformation. We will never get away from that fact.
"But we have got to concentrate on where we are now. Although it is fantastic it will be worth nothing if we don't see it out."
Given Leicester's familiarity with both the Premier League relegation and title races over the past year, Albrighton said the pressure at the top isn't as intense.
"That was totally different. There was a lot more pressure last season but I haven't felt any pressure this season.
"I can't see why there is any on us. We are in a position no one expected us to be in.
"If we don't go on and achieve something now then don't get me wrong, we would be disappointed.
"We are aiming for the top and if we can achieve that then fantastic but if we don't then it is not a massive loss."
